2024 ANRF Annual Research Scholar Symposium: A Celebration of Collaboration and Discovery

As the curtains close on another successful ANRF Annual Research Scholar Symposium, we find ourselves reflecting on the wealth of knowledge, insight, and connections shared during this transformative event. From captivating keynote speeches to thought-provoking panel discussions, the symposium delivered the latest discoveries and innovations in arthritis and autoimmune disease research.

Highlights and Memorable Moments
Throughout the symposium, attendees had the opportunity to delve into a myriad of topics, each shedding light on critical aspects of arthritis and autoimmune diseases. Highlights included renowned experts Hal Hoffman, MD, and Lori Broderick, MD, PhD, who delivered compelling keynote addresses, offering insights into disease mechanisms and therapeutic interventions. Two panels, “Finding Funding Success” and “The Business of Running a Lab,” called on expert alumni and members of ANRF’s Scientific Advisory Board to share their experiences. These panels provided a platform for vibrant discussions and knowledge exchange.

Among the standout moments of the symposium included was the heartfelt speech delivered by patient speaker Adriana Gonzalez, whose 25-year journey with Lupus underscored the profound impact of research on patients’ lives. Additionally, the presentations by second-year ANRF scholars and the inaugural poster session featuring first-year scholars added depth and diversity to the symposium, showcasing the promising research being conducted by emerging scientists.
